When the folks at Tested wanted a real life Zoidberg costume from Futurama, they decided to work with effects artist Frank Ippolito to make it happen. He oversaw every part of the build from design to sculpting to molding to painting. Their Zoidberg even has some built in animatronics. Ippolito made a video with Tested and went over the process, and it gives helpful insight into how such a costume comes to life.
